Description

Human Factor XII is a single chain glycoprotein with a molecular weight of about 80,000. Once activated, principally from the action of kallikrein, Factor XII is converted into an active serine protease (Factor -Xlla) that functions in the in vivo initiation of blood coagulation, fibrinolysis, and kinin formation. Human Factor XII has been purified by ion exchange chromatography.
